clarkwgriswold Posted 22 hours ago Report Posted 22 hours ago Stan Heath brings his 6-5 EMU Eagles to the JAR Friday night to face the Zips, coming off of exam week. Like many other teams, EMU had to completely rebuild, returning only 7.9% of their minutes from last year. 6'9" redshirt Central Michigan transfer Mohammad Habnad leads the Eagles with 14.9 ppg and 8.1 rpg. 6'7" redshirt senior guard Addison Peterson, who's on his 5th college team, averages 11.5 rpg and 5.1 rpg. They have wins over Georgia State, Cincinnati, Detroit Mercy, Oakland, NJIT and Cleary. Their losses are to Pitt, UPFW, Louisville, Butler and and IU Indy.
